site stats

React setstate append to array

WebArrays are mutable in JavaScript, but you should treat them as immutable when you store them in state. Just like with objects, when you want to update an array stored in state, … WebMar 13, 2024 · To update a React component state array with a new item at the end of it, we can pass in a callback to the state setter function that takes the old array value and return …

在React中使用setState修改数组的值时,为什么不能使用数组的可 …

WebJun 4, 2024 · Both the ways changes the mutation state of an array. A mutation term is meant to be unchanged because it is our original source. array.concat. The concat() … shooting range chesterland ohio https://danmcglathery.com

How to Add to an Array in React State using Hooks

WebOct 5, 2024 · Create React project yarn create react-app yourprojectname Now install Axios yarn add axios Paste the below code inside your project app.js file. An array of data from API This is just a... WebNov 29, 2024 · Your state is an array so you will need to spread your previous state into a new array and add the new message using [...prevState, newMessage] What you try to do … Web2 days ago · I am trying to set an array of messages once I have loaded all necessary data from firestore, but it seems I have one too many await/asyncs in there as the output … shooting range challenges in gta v online

React: Warning: setState(...): Не удается обновить во время …

Category:How to Push or Append an Element to a State Array with React …

Tags:React setstate append to array

React setstate append to array

Correct modification of state arrays in React.js

WebFeb 24, 2024 · Setup React Image Upload with Preview Project Open cmd at the folder you want to save Project folder, run command: npx create-react-app react-image-upload-preview Or: yarn create react-app react-image-upload-preview After the process is done. We create additional folders and files like the following tree: public src components WebReact: Warning: setState(...): Не удается обновить во время перехода существующего состояния Мой проект держит краш когда я пытаюсь вставить новый элемент рецепта.

React setstate append to array

Did you know?

WebIn my Main app file, I create a state and pass an array as the first value: const [state, setState] = useState ( [1, 2, 3, 4]). Then I pass down state and setState down to one component, say Container. There I render 4 Item components (as many as items in the array), and pass down state, setState, as well as their index to them. WebMay 4, 2024 · This is a cheat sheet on how to do add, remove, and update items in an array or object within the context of managing React state. Arrays const [todos, setTodos] = …

Web2 days ago · I am trying to set an array of messages once I have loaded all necessary data from firestore, but it seems I have one too many await/asyncs in there as the output results in [{"_A": null,... WebFeb 7, 2024 · useState is React Hook that allows you to add state to a functional component. It returns an array with two values: the current state and a function to update it. The Hook takes an initial state value as an argument and returns an updated state value whenever the setter function is called. It can be used like this:

WebAug 20, 2024 · An easy way to treat a state array as immutable these days is: let list = Array.from (this.state.list); list.push ('woo'); this.setState ( {list}); Modify to your style … WebTo add an object to a state array, we have to use the spread syntax (...) to unpack the elements of the array and add the object at the end. App.js const addObjectToArray = obj => { setEmployees(current => [...current, obj]); }; addObjectToArray({ id: …

WebApr 15, 2024 · 在React中使用 setState 修改数组的值时,不推荐使用数组的可变方法(如push、unshift等)。. 这是因为React会对比新旧状态,在发现状态变化后,更新组件的渲染。. 但当你调用可变方法修改数组时,虽然数组已经被改变, 但数组的地址并没有发生变化 ,React并不会 ...

WebuseState is a React Hook that lets you add a state variable to your component. const [state, setState] = useState(initialState) Reference useState (initialState) set functions, like setSomething (nextState) Usage Adding state to a component Updating state based on the previous state Updating objects and arrays in state shooting range cinnaminson njWebNov 4, 2024 · The useState hook is a function that takes in a default value as a parameter (which can be empty) and returns an array containing the state and a function to update … shooting range clearwater flWebDec 6, 2024 · Updating an array of objects You might have come across different use cases where you would want to store an array in the React state and later modify them. In this article, we will see different ways of doing it. Project setup Create a react project by running the following command: 1npx create-react-app react-usestate-array shooting range clarksville tnWebSep 22, 2024 · How to push to an array in React state. My first idea to add an item to a React state was using .push(), a typical JavaScript method to append to the end of an array. The … shooting range cleveland tnWeb7 hours ago · I have a Next.js project with Redux. In my store, there is an array of state which updates via Redux reducers. Basically an array of state I use a lot, across some components. In one of my reducers, I sort this array. The array is full of objects, which I sort through a specific property. When I console.log the array, it seems to have sorted fine. shooting range cincinnatiWebJust use Object.assign () as suggested here to make a copy of your state. Thus, you can do it as follows : let new_state = Object.assign ( {}, this.state); let a = new_state.arr; a [index] = "random element"; this.setState ( {arr: a}); Hope it helps. Share Improve this answer Follow … shooting range clinton iowaWebApr 14, 2024 · Step 1: Create React App by using the following command. npx create-react-app foldername Step 2: After creating your project folder, i.e., folder name, move to it using the following command: cd foldername > Project Structure: It will look like the following. App.js import React, { Component } from 'react'; class App extends Component { state = { shooting range cluj